Common Misconceptions
1. AI is going to replace all human jobs
Many people have the misconception that AI will replace all human jobs and render people unemployed. However, this is not entirely true. While AI can automate certain repetitive tasks and improve efficiency, it is unlikely to completely replace the unique skills and creativity that humans possess.
- AI can enhance productivity and complement human work, rather than replace it.
- Jobs that require complex decision-making, critical thinking, and interpersonal skills are generally safe from AI takeover.
- AI technology can create new job opportunities and industries as it continues to advance.
2. AI is a magical solution to all problems
Another common misconception is that AI is a magical solution that can solve all problems. While AI technology has made significant advancements and can offer valuable solutions, it also has limitations. It is important to have realistic expectations and understand the boundaries of AI.
- AI systems rely heavily on the quality of data they receive, and data biases can impact the accuracy and fairness of AI algorithms.
- AI algorithms are only as good as their training, and they require ongoing monitoring and fine-tuning.
- Certain tasks, such as tasks requiring empathy or creativity, may be beyond the capabilities of AI.
3. AI possesses human-like intelligence
Many people believe that AI possesses human-like intelligence, capable of reasoning, understanding, and feeling emotions. However, current AI technology mainly focuses on narrow, specific tasks and lacks complex human-like intelligence.
- AI systems excel in pattern recognition and data analysis but struggle with understanding context and common sense reasoning.
- AI algorithms can mimic human behavior in certain situations, but they do not possess consciousness or emotions.
- AI technology is continually evolving, and future advancements may bring us closer to human-like intelligence.
4. AI is inherently biased
Another misconception is that AI is inherently biased and discriminates against certain groups of people. While it is true that AI algorithms can exhibit bias, it is not an inherent trait of AI itself. Bias in AI systems often stems from the biases present in the data used to train them.
- AI bias can be minimized through careful data selection and preprocessing, as well as diverse and inclusive training datasets.
- Ethical considerations and ongoing monitoring are crucial to ensure AI systems are fair and unbiased.
- Awareness of the potential for bias in AI technologies is important to address and mitigate these issues.
5. AI technology is too complex and inaccessible for non-experts
Some people believe that AI technology is too complex and only accessible to experts in the field. While developing advanced AI systems requires expertise, there are user-friendly tools and platforms available that make AI accessible to a broader audience.
- AI frameworks and libraries, like TensorFlow and PyTorch, provide resources and documentation for developers and researchers.
- Many companies offer AI-powered products and services that can be used by individuals and businesses without deep technical knowledge.
- Online courses and tutorials are available to learn the basics of AI and machine learning for those interested in exploring the field.

AI Ethics Concerns
While AI brings remarkable advancements, it also raises crucial ethical concerns. This table highlights some of the major AI ethics issues that researchers and policymakers are grappling with.
Ethics Concern | Description |
Privacy | Unintended data collection and potential misuse of personal information |
Transparency | The black box problem – difficulty in understanding AI decision-making processes |
Job Displacement | Potential loss of employment due to automation |
Algorithmic Bias | Prejudice or unfairness in AI algorithms, leading to discrimination |
Social Impact | Ethical dilemmas in AI application domains like autonomous weapons |

Biggest Challenges in AI Development
Developing AI systems comes with its fair share of challenges. This table provides an overview of the most significant hurdles faced by AI researchers and developers.
Challenge | Description |
Data Limitations | Insufficient and biased datasets for training AI models |
Lack of Interpretability | Difficulty in understanding and explaining AI decision-making processes |
Ethical Dilemmas | Making AI systems accountable and avoiding harmful consequences |
Security Risks | Potential vulnerabilities and potential misuse of AI systems |
Scalability | Scaling AI technologies to handle large-scale applications |
AI in Science Fiction vs. Reality
Science fiction has often depicted AI in both utopian and dystopian ways. This table presents a comparison between popular science fiction portrayals and the current reality of AI development.
Aspect | Science Fiction | Reality |
General AI | Superintelligent, human-like AI capable of surpassing human capabilities | Narrow AI systems focused on specific tasks, not human-like |
Robotics | Advanced humanoid robots with emotions and consciousness | Robotics primarily focused on industrial applications and assistance |
Singularity | The emergence of an AI-driven singularity altering human existence | Debated concept; no evidence of imminent singularity |
Moral Dilemmas | AI uprising and existential threats to humanity | Current ethical concerns center around accountability and biased algorithms |
